The smiley face murder theory (also known as the smiley face murders, smiley face killings, and smiley face gang) is a theory advanced by retired New York City detectives Kevin Gannon and Anthony Duarte, as well as Dr. Lee Gilbertson, a criminal justice professor and gang expert at St. Cloud State University. Dec 7, 2018 · In the majority of the cases, the victims were successful students and athletes who disappeared after a night out drinking with friends, and they were ultimately found dead in a body of water. At some of the sites where the victims' bodies were found, smiley face graffiti had been left behind.
